MKS takes charge


The 09' MKS seems to be a promising car to finally replace the ill-fated Lincoln LS. I hope Lincoln spends the money promoting the vehicle and showing the world what they have. Now that Ford has sold Land Rover and Jaguar, Aston Martin, and plans of making Mercury dissapear by 2011. Ford just might have the time and money to put the much needed money into this one proud luxury brand. That hopefully means no more chrome Fords as Lincolns. The MKZ was Lincolns offical start. The MKX is also doing very well for the brand, however it still needs more distinctive Lincoln in its dna. Lincoln plans for the future are as follows, dropping the Mark LT by the end of 2008. The Towncar is expected to live until 2011, when Lincoln should have a replacement flagship sedan. The future of the Navigator is unknown, production has slowed down dramatically due to rising gas prices. The MKZ is due for a refresh and should be released in 2009. No plans for the MKX are known either. Lincoln will finally offer a bigger crossover in a year or so. Having said all of the above, Lincolns future is promising, the MKS is a great part to the future of the company.
